Can Art Therapy Help Those with ADHD?

By Jeff Copper, MBA, PCC, PCAC, CPCC, ACG – June 9, 2025

Those with ADHD often struggle with communicating their needs or struggles. When I heard about art therapy as a mode of support for these challenges, I contacted art therapists Holly Oberacker and Tracey Bromley Goodwin, founders of Navigating ADHD, Inc. What I learned about art therapy was eye-opening as an innovative clinical treatment.

Art therapy can be used to address social, emotional, and communication needs of both children and adults in navigating ADHD. It is used to express emotions and is geared toward improving self-esteem or mood. This treatment is designed also to help find strengths in people across the board to get children, adults, teachers, and families on the same page in the way they communicate.

For example, children who have a difficult school year and, as a result, develop low self-esteem or lose motivation, this unique therapy can guide them to explore things of their specific interests. ADHD is about boredom, so finding what stimulates the brain can renew a child’s motivation. Art therapy helps the child analyze the situation himself, but it is also very effective in adults with ADHD.

My discussion with Holly and Tracey explored the innovative ways in which art-based activities and creative expressions can serve as powerful tools for self-discovery and healing. But art therapy goes beyond art. It also includes educational coaching sessions to translate the individual’s artistic insights into actionable steps so that they can build skills with effective strategies to manage their challenges.

The collaboration between Holly and Tracey combines art therapy and educational coaching in promoting mental, emotional, and social growth. It can inspire individuals, especially children and families, to seek a more fulfilling life with ADHD.
